I recently listened (cheating I know ;) to "How to Read a Book" by Mortimer J. Adler. https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/567610.How_to_Read_a_Boo... It is an old book, 1940/1972 but still relevant.

Their philosophy is basically to focus on quality rather than quantity. Find the books worth reading and read them at "normal" speed.

“Great speed in reading is a dubious achievement; it is of value only if what you have to read is not really worth reading. A better formula is this: Every book should be read no more slowly than it deserves, and no more quickly than you can read it with satisfaction and comprehension.”

― Mortimer J. Adler, How to Read a Book: The Classic Guide to Intelligent Reading
